Justin Timberlake channels Steve Jobs in new Filthy music video
So this wasn't what we were expecting.
.Justin Timberlake is giving the world a taste of what's to come from his forthcoming album Man of the Woods, with the single "Filthy".
"Filthy" began trending on Twitter soon after the track and its music video dropped at midnight, as the pop superstar's followers turned it up en masse. "It's unbelievable", tweeted one fan.

The 10-time Grammy victor released the first track, Filthy, from the album today (Jan 5), and it has been met with a mixed reaction.
In the visual, we see JT playing the role of a Steve Jobs-esque tech visionary presenting one of his latest creations at the Pan-Asian Deep Learning Conference in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ia.

"Man of the Woods" is set for release on February 2nd, and Timberlake will headline the Super Bowl Halftime Show two days later on February 4th.
